Интернет, компьютеры, софт и прочий Hi-Tech

Подписаться через RSS2Email.ru

Страницы, снабженные тегом

программирование

Что такое рефакторинг?
В статье дается понятие рефакторинга, указывается необходимость его применения и перечислено ПО для его использования. Прежде всего рефакторинг повышает степень читабельности кода, облегчает его понимание и повышает производительность программиста.
Что такое компьютерная программа
Компьютерная программа — это последовательность инструкций, которая предназначена для исполнения вычислительной машиной. Образ программы, чаще всего, хранится в памяти машины (например, на диске) как исполняемый модуль (один или несколько файлов)...
Документация для программиста — виды и особенности
Сведений на эту тему много, однако в них легко запутаться и заблудиться, вплоть до симптомов переутомления из-за попыток объять необъятное. Поэтому попытаемся сделать обзор на простом, человеческом языке, без официозного пафоса и прочей канцелярщины.
Работа с com-портом в Делфи при помощи драйвера AsyncFree104
В этой статье рассматривается пример работы с компонентами Delphi для работы с Com — портом из библиотеки AsyncFree104, которые можно скачать с SourceForge.net. Для установки необходимо извлечь файлы из архива и необходимые версии скопировать в LIB...
Команды CREATE, ALTER и DROP TABLE; Допустимые пределы и не поддерживаемые возможности — Поддержка внешних ключей в SQLite
Этот документ описывает поддержку внешних ключей SQL, реализованных в SQLite версии 3.6.19. В главе 5 описывается, как работают команды ALTER и DROP TABLE при наличии внешних ключей. В заключительной 6 главе перечисляются ограничения текущей реализации.
Операции ON DELETE и ON UPDATE — Продвинутые возможности внешних ключей — Поддержка внешних ключей в SQLite
Этот документ описывает поддержку внешних ключей SQL, реализованных в SQLite версии 3.6.19. Продолжение перевода. Глава 4 описывает продвинутые возможности, связанные с внешними ключами, поддерживаемыми в SQLite. Операции ON DELETE и ON UPDATE.
Продвинутые возможности внешних ключей — Поддержка внешних ключей в SQLite
Этот документ описывает поддержку внешних ключей SQL, реализованных в SQLite версии 3.6.19. Ранее уже были опубликованы три главы. Продолжение перевода. Глава 4 описывает продвинутые возможности, связанные с внешними ключами, поддерживаемыми в SQLite.
Включение поддержки внешних ключей; Необходимые и желательные индексы базы данных — Поддержка внешних ключей в SQLite
Этот документ описывает поддержку внешних ключей, реализованных в SQLite версии 3.6.19. Вторая глава описывает, что сделать для включения внешних ключей. Третья глава описывает, какие индексы нужно создать для эффективного использования внешних ключей.
Поддержка внешних ключей в SQLite
Этот документ описывает поддержку внешних ключей SQL, реализованных в SQLite версии 3.6.19. Первая глава посвящена общей концепции внешних ключей в SQLite, объясняет ее с помощью примеров и определений, необходимых для понимания данного документа.
Типы данных в SQLite версии 3
SQLite использует динамическую типизацию, когда тип значения связан с самим значением, а не с его контейнером. Такая типизация имеет обратную совместимость со статическими системами других СУБД. SQL-запросы других баз данных должны работать и с SQLite...
Исходный код — лучшая документация для программиста
Исходный код всегда должен быть внятным, даже если вы пишете программу для себя. Чтобы потом, когда из памяти выветрятся подробности, не искать долго и мучительно, а где же тот участок, который требует доработки, не напрягать глаза, вникая в ужасную кашу.
Загружаемые расширения SQLite
Начиная с версии 3.3.6 SQLite позволяет загружать новые функции SQL и сортирующие последовательности из разделяемых библиотек и DLL. Это означает, что вам больше ненужно перекомпилировать SQLite, чтобы добавлять в него новые функции и сортировки.
PHP — защита скачиваемых файлов
Обработка скачивания файла и запись статистики в базу данных MySQL. Хотите предотвратить установку ссылок на файлы для скачивания? Данный сценарий будет загружать страницу перед скачиванием файла. PHP используется для передачи файла и HTTP-заголовков.
Компиляция и использование библиотеки libstemmer_c
Этот документ является переводом файла README, который является частью дистрибутива C-шной версии библиотеки libstemmer. Библиотека предоставляет простое API на C для стемминга слов нескольких языков. Библиотека более известна как стеммер Портера.
Советы по разработке приложений поиска — SQLite: расширения FTS3 и FTS4
Изначально FTS был разработан для поддержки логического полнотекстового поиска — запросы должны находить набор документов, которые удовлетворяют заданным критериям. Однако большинство приложений поиска требуют ранжирования результатов по релевантности...
Компиляция и включение FTS3 и FTS4, запросы с использованием полнотекстового индекса — SQLite: расширения FTS3 и FTS4
Несмотря на то, что FTS3 и FTS4 входят в состав исходного кода SQLite, они не включаются по умолчанию. Для сборки SQLite с включенной функциональностью FTS, нужно при компиляции определить макрос препроцессора SQLITE_ENABLE_FTS3. Есть и другие опции.
Структуры данных — SQLite: расширения FTS3 и FTS4
Этот раздел описывает, как FTS хранит свой индекс и данные. Прочтение и понимание этого материала не является обязательным для использования FTS в приложениях. Однако это может быть полезно для тех разработчиков, которые хотят расширить возможности FTS.
Токенайзеры — SQLite: расширения FTS3 и FTS4
Токенайзер FTS — это набор правил для извлечения термов из документа или простого полнотекстового запроса FTS. Если при создании таблицы FTS в запросе CREATE VIRTUAL TABLE не был указан какой-то специфический токенайзер, то будет использован «simple»...
SQLite: расширения FTS3 и FTS4
FTS3 и FTS4 — это модули виртуальных таблиц SQLite, которые позволяют пользователям выполнять полнотекстовый поиск на множестве документов. Наиболее общий способ описать полнотекстовый поиск: «То, что делают Google и Yahoo с документами в Мировой сети».
Вспомогательные функции — Snippet, Offsets и Matchinfo — SQLite: расширения FTS3 и FTS4
Модули FTS3 и FTS4 предоставляют три специальные функции: «snippet», «offsets» и «matchinfo». Функции «snippet» и «offsets» позволяют узнать местоположение искомых термов в найденных документах, а «matchinfo» используется для вычисления релевантности.
Простейший способ подружить XBB и Codeigniter 2
Берём наш XBB и кладём в директорию [путь до папки]/application/libraries/ В папку bbcode у вас ...
BBCode [spoiler] с некоторыми улучшениями.
Это тестовая модель данного ббкода. И так различение между моим споллером и споллером http://xbb....
Вопрос по MySQL и SQL
Возможно сделать запрос такова типа. У нас есть таблицы forums , forum_threads , forum_posts , ...
x[BB] - Дополнительные BBCODE может кому пригодится.
Делал для себя сильно не ругать мне 18 лет да Php начал изучать только не давно и возможно всё это...
Как начать писать программу на C
Многие люди задаются вопросом, как начать писать ту или иную программу. Лучший совет — просто начать писать макет программы. — Практический подход написания собственных программ для начинающего программиста. Объясняются подходы top-down и bottom-up.
FAQ по парсеру BBCode. Справка и файлы
Ответы на вопросы: 1) Есть ваш архив, который скачивают пользователи, но в нем нет справки как пользоваться библиотекой((( 2) В архиве куча файлов, и ни где не написано древо соединения файлов, какой файл какой подгружает.
XPCOM
Эта страница является переводом страницы http://www.mozilla.org/projects/xpcom/, которая является главной страницей проекта XPCOM и центральной страницей документации, связанной с XPCOM.
xBB 0.29 API — инициализация объекта bbcode
Одна из глав документации по xBB v0.29 — парсеру BBCode, написанному на PHP. Библиотека является объектно-ориентированной. Объект класса bbcode может быть инициализирован без параметров или с параметрами описанных на этой странице типов.

© 2007-2012, Дмитрий Скоробогатов.
Разрешается воспроизводить, распространять и/или изменять материалы сайта
в соответствии с условиями GNU Free Documentation License,
версии 1.2 или любой более поздней версии, опубликованной FSF,
если только иное не указано в самих материалах.